Title: Beggars of Life Author: Jim Tully Narrator: Clay Lomakayu Format: mp3 Length: 5 hrs and 54 mins Release date: 12-16-21 Ratings: 4 out of 5 stars, 4 ratings Genres: Poverty & Homelessness Publisher's Summary: From the opening conversation on a railroad trestle, Beggars of Life rattles along like the Fast Flyer Virginia that Tully boards midway through the story. This is the book that defined Tully’s hard-boiled style and set the pattern for the 12 books that followed over the next two decades. Startling in its originality and intensity, Beggars of Life is a breakneck journey made while clinging to the lowest rungs of the social ladder.
